Property summary
This exceptional 0.32-acre commercial land parcel is strategically located on West 2nd Street in Little Rock, Arkansas, within the 72201 zip code. Zoned UU, this property presents a unique opportunity for developers seeking a foothold in a rapidly evolving urban core. Its prime location offers unparalleled proximity to key areas, including the Arkansas State Capitol, the vibrant Financial Corridor, the bustling River Market District, and the dynamic Main Street Corridor. The site benefits from its position in a designated growth area, experiencing significant recent redevelopment activity in the immediate vicinity. This translates to a strong potential for future appreciation and a thriving environment for new construction. The property's size makes it suitable for a variety of commercial ventures, capitalizing on the high demand for space in this central location. This is a rare chance to acquire a piece of Little Rock's burgeoning downtown landscape, offering substantial returns for forward-thinking investors and developers. The property's address is W 2nd St, Little Rock, Pulaski County, AR. The asking price is $139,000.
